ABOUT RONA GLYNN-MCDONALD
DJ, musician, entertainer, artist, performer, instrumentalist, guitarist, violinist, and music producer who is known by the artist name RONA. She played at Australia's Falls Festival and Sugar Mountain Festival. She plays various instruments including violin and guitar.
She started producing in the year 2016.
She is an advocate for Australian First Nations rights. She has also served as the CEO of the not-for-profit group Common Ground. She co-founded First Nations Futures. In the year 2022, she released her debut EP titled Closure.
She has Kaytetye heritage. In the year 2023, she started dating Australian television host Tony Armstrong.
She supported Rüfüs Du Sol on tour.
